Job Overview

At Brantner and Associates, Inc, we are seeking a skilled Assembly Operator to join our team. As an Assembly Operator, you will play a critical role in ensuring the quality and productivity of our manufacturing processes.

Responsibilities:
  • Assemble and align parts and fixtures using hand and power tools.
  • Inspect all work for quality and compliance with design standards.
  • Perform hydrostatic testing to products, in accordance with work instructions.
  • Ensure continuous operations by performing readjustments, fixing jams and misfeeds.
  • Perform in-process and final inspection of terminals to ensure that QIP specifications are met.
  • Prepare finished parts for material handling.
  • Be flexible and respond to multiple assignments.
Requirements:
  • High School Diploma or equivalent.
  • 1 year of manufacturing experience required.
  • 1 year of experience with manufacturing machine setup.
  • SAP manufacturing and ISO 9001 experience preferred but not required.
  • Fiber optics experience preferred but not required.
  • Working knowledge of hand tools and print reading.
  • A safe quality-conscious attitude working in a team environment.
  • Ability to work overtime as needed.
Physical Requirements:
  • Ability to push/pull/carry a minimum of 50 lbs.
  • Frequent walking and standing required.
  • Frequent use of hands and arms to extend between knees and shoulders.
